![]() |
TBitmap unter NET
Hallo,
ich habe viel in Delphi32 programmiert, möchte jetzt aber auch halbwegs mit NET was hinbekommen. Die größte Hürde dabei ist zurzeit Multimedia, insbesondere erstmal Bitmaps. Wie kann ich denn überhaupt TBitmap in einem NET-Projekt nutzen? Ich habe in der Borland-Hilfe zu NET den Artikel "TBitmap Klasse" angeschaut, aber bin leider nicht ganz schlau draus geworden, was ich nun einbinden muss. Da steht bei Hierachie z.B. Borland.Vcl.Graphics.TGraphic Woher weiß ich generell, was ich einzubinden habe, wenn so was dasteht. Ist es sinnvoll zur Bildbearbeitung/Verwaltung TBitmap unter NET zu benutzen? Weil irgendwie ist ja TBitmap VCL. Gibt es eine reine NET-Alternative, mit der man auch ordentlich arbeiten kann? Sprich so was in der Art wie Canvas sollte schon dabei sein. Kann ich auch BitBlt in NET-Projekten nutzen oder gibt es da eine Alternative? |
Re: TBitmap unter NET
Hat noch keiner irgendwelche Erfahrungen mit Bitmaps unter NET gemacht?
|
Re: TBitmap unter NET
Es gibt doch eine (System.Graphics.Drawing2d.(??))Bitmap Klasse. Mit der kannst du auch laden und speichern. Zum bearbeiten musdt du dann ein Graphic-Objekt draus machen (new Graphic(Bitmap) bzw. Graphic.Create(Bitmap)).
Änderungen am Graphic-Objekt wirken sich direkt auf das Bitmap-Objekt aus! (Ich arbeite nur mit C# unter .Net, also könnte das alles ein bisschen anders heissen...) |
Re: TBitmap unter NET
Ah hab es gefunden.
Speichern (Save) habe ich zwar gefunden bei Bitmap, aber nicht wie man ein Bild von einer Datei ladet. .NET Framework Class Library ist zwar gut, aber für Delphi nicht so passend, weil die Bsp ja nicht für Delphi dastehen. Weiß jemand, was man am besten zur Anzeigen von Bildern in NET unter Delphi nimmt? PictureBox gibt es z.B. Bei Delphi32 ist es wohl TImage vorrangig. |
Re: TBitmap unter NET
Zitat:
Zitat:
Zitat:
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 00:20 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z